We are a dedicated United Airlines partner operating over 1,600 weekly flights, connecting people and their communities to the world via United’s Global Network. With corporate headquarters in Cleveland, Ohio, we operate a large fleet of Embraer 145 XR aircraft from two hubs in Houston and Washington Dulles, along with maintenance bases in Houston, Albany, NY, and Lincoln, NE. What the position is The CommuteAir Flight Attendant performs or assists in the performance of all in-flight safety, customer service, and cabin preparation duties, along with communicating and cooperating with the flight and ground crews, as a member of the team. Essential Functions Ensure safety standards on board are met and passengers comply with applicable FAA and company regulations and policies. Provide outstanding customer service and assist passengers while on board while representing not only CommuteAir but also our codeshare partner United Airlines. Complete necessary checklists and paperwork and reports as outlined in the Flight Attendant Manual Communicate effectively with pilots and ground crew to ensure efficient and safe operation of flights. Be prepared to handle an emergency at any time during a flight. Comply with company policies as outlined in the Flight Attendant Manual and Employee Handbook. Other duties as assigned and agreed upon in applicable Collective Bargaining Agreement. Must be at least 21 years of age. Must be legally authorized to work in the United States (A citizen or national of the United States, a lawful permanent resident, or an alien authorized to work). Must be in possession of a valid United States or foreign passport with applicable VISAs. Must have the right to travel freely in and out of the United States, to and from all cities served by CommuteAir without restriction. Fluent in the English language, both written and spoken. Satisfactory 10-year background history, including criminal background. High school diploma or general education degree (GED). Minimum 2 years of customer service experience. Ability to always comply with company uniform and grooming standards while on duty. Our policies do not allow for any visible tattoos or piercings other than in the ears. Professionalism – always maintain composure and professional appearance. Mathematics – using mathematics to solve problems and complete paperwork. Reading comprehension - understanding text in work-related documents. Listening – giving full attention to what others are saying, ask questions as appropriate to clarify understanding. Evaluating new information for both current and future problem-solving and decision making. Communication – excellent verbal and written interaction with passengers, coworkers, and vendor/contractor representatives. Physical Requirements Medium Work - Exerting up to 50 lbs. of force occasionally and/or up to 20 lbs. of force frequently, and/or up to 10 lbs. of force consistently to move objects.
